Who We Are Intel Silicon Architecture, Power-Performance (SiA PTP) team is looking for a highly skilled SoC performance engineer to join our PnP validation team. We are a post silicon team responsible for attaining SOC-IP power-performance expectations for Intel's client products. Who You Are This role requires regular onsite presence to fulfill essential job responsibilities. And the responsibilities are as follows but not limited to: Performs low-level and complex debug for multiple systems, subsystems within a product, or at the SoC level for Intel products. Works to continuously improve the debug discipline through new design for debug (DFD) tools and scripts. Applies deep understanding of SoC design, architecture, firmware, and software to resolve triage failures, marginality issues, and conduct root cause analysis. As a PnP validation engineer, you will be able to develop, execute validation test plans and directed tests to ensure adherence to validation standards and procedures. In this role, you will have the opportunity to work on cutting edge technology, use best in class systems and equipment. We expect you to have good scripting skills and be able to process large amounts of performance data, use automation for analyzing and optimizing SOC performance. You will also work closely with cross-functional teams to ensure our SoCs meet the highest standards of performance, power efficiency and identifying opportunities for improvement. Additional Preferred Qualifications are OSPM (Operating System-directed Power Management) knowledge including PPM, P-states, C-states, and thermal management experience is a plus. PnP Benchmark expertise with industry-standard performance benchmarks and power-performance characterization methodologies is highly desirable.
